Tip of the Week: Update, Repair and Verify Games
This Week’s Pro Tip: Use the sliders menu on any installed game to update, repair, or verify your game files - all without leaving Game Mode!
Note: This feature works in both versions of Junk Store.
The Problem
Every now and then we get questions about how to update games due to new patches, or how to add newly purchased DLC content to already downloaded games (i.e. Cyberpunk 2077). Don’t waste time downloading games over and over again, instead use the Update, Repair or Verify functionality built into Junk Store without leaving Game Mode or needing to restart your Steam Deck.
Common scenarios when you may need to use this:
- Newly purchased DLC content isn’t showing up in-game
- New patch released for one of your games - Rocket League, Fall Guys, ZZZ, Arknights: Enfield, etc.
- During download some game files got corrupted
- Game crashing on launch that was working fine
Where you can find these functions:
- Go to your installed game in Junk Store
- Open the game details
- Select the sliders menu (three lines icon)

- Pick Update, Repair, or Verify

What each function does:
Update
Self explanatory but just in case…this will download updates only or new DLC content to save you downloading the game over and over again.
Verify
Sometimes during download things can go wonky. This will verify downloaded files against the game’s manifest to check if anything is missing or corrupted.
Repair
If any files are missing or corrupted this will download those files causing issues and preventing the game from launching.
